New Delhi: The Pradhan Mantri Jan Dhan Yojana has opened over 49 crore accounts since it began. Deposits into the Jan Dhan account are more than two lakh crore rupees. The program’s stated goal is to give all citizens of the nation access to banking services. It was introduced in 2014. In a written response to a question in the Lok Sabha today, Minister of State for Finance Dr. Bhagwat Karad stated this.

As per him, basic financial services like cash deposits, withdrawals, fund transfers, balance inquiries, and mini statements are sent to bank customers via banking shops. According to him, the government keeps an eye on the existence of banking facilities for offering financial services within five kilometres of all populated communities. More than 99 percent of the more than six lakh inhabited villages on the map, according to the minister, have access to a banking facility.
